ZeroKernel: Secure context-isolated execution on commodity GPUs

O Kwon, Y Kim, J Huh, H Yoon - IEEE Transactions on …, 2019 - ieeexplore.ieee.org
In the last decade, the dedicated graphics processing unit (GPU) has emerged as an
architecture for high-performance computing workloads. Recently, researchers have also …

[PDF][PDF] Understanding outstanding memory request handling resources in gpgpus

A Lashgar, E Salehi, A Baniasadi - proceedings of The Sixth …, 2015 - ahmado.com
During recent years, GPU micro-architectures have changed dramatically, evolving into
powerful many-core deep-multithreaded platforms for parallel workloads. While important …

A case study in reverse engineering gpgpus: Outstanding memory handling resources

A Lashgar, E Salehi, A Baniasadi - ACM SIGARCH Computer …, 2016 - dl.acm.org
During recent years, GPU micro-architectures have changed dramatically, evolving into
powerful many-core deep-multithreaded platforms for parallel workloads. While important …

Reducing shared cache requests and preventing duplicate entries

A Brizio - US Patent 10,545,872, 2020 - Google Patents
Techniques are described for reducing shared cache memory requests in a multi-threaded
microprocessor-based system. One method includes receiving a request for data from a …

Addressing software-managed cache development effort in GPGPUs

A Lashgar - 2017 - dspace.library.uvic.ca
GPU Computing promises very high performance per watt for highly-parallelizable
workloads. Nowadays, there are various programming models developed to utilize the …